Web20 mrt. 2024 · OSHA’s rules for bloodborne pathogens apply to exposure to blood as well as “other potentially infectious materials” (OPIM) that contain blood. Bodily fluids that do not carry an inherent risk of transmitting bloodborne pathogens, such as saliva and feces, are not normally considered OPIM under OSHA’s bloodborne pathogen (BBP) standards.
